Christian Walker had a remarkable performance at Dodger Stadium, hitting two home runs in the game against the Los Angeles Dodgers. This marked his 18th and 19th home runs in just 42 career games at the ballpark. The Arizona Diamondbacks secured a 9-3 victory over the NL West-leading Dodgers.

Walker expressed his astonishment at his performance, stating that he was speechless. The Dodgers, who are now 4-5 against the D-backs this season, will not face them again in Los Angeles until possibly the postseason. Last year, Arizona surprised the Dodgers in the first round of the playoffs.

In the first inning, Joc Pederson, playing against his former team, received boos from the crowd as he hit a home run. Shortly after, Walker hit a massive 435-foot shot to center field. In the third inning, with two strikes, Walker hit another two-run shot to extend Arizona’s lead to 4-0. This marked his fifth consecutive game hitting a home run at Dodger Stadium and his ninth home run against Dodgers pitching this season.

Walker, who hails from the same hometown as late Dodgers manager Tommy Lasorda, expressed his pride in his performance. He credited his teammates and hitting coaches for his success. He also received his first intentional walk of the series in the fifth inning and drew a walk in the ninth inning to load the bases.

The D-backs’ victory was supported by strong relief pitching from Justin Martinez, who earned the win. The team scored 14 consecutive runs between the previous game and this one, showcasing their offensive prowess.

Despite the Dodgers’ efforts to cut the deficit, they fell short as their lead in the NL West decreased to 6½ games over San Diego. Key players like Shohei Ohtani and Freddie Freeman struggled, striking out multiple times in the game.

In the ninth inning, the D-backs added four more runs to secure their victory. Arizona third baseman Eugenio Suárez was ejected in the eighth inning after a dispute with the home plate umpire.
